Output 07abbf312748e1b5cb00188041c694cf7f388d0d3eb1ea01e2f655465961290d:107

value
9983581
script pubkey
OP_0 OP_PUSHBYTES_20 84e909cc146569cec4a1c98b62ef854640df8d57
address
bc1qsn5snnq5v45ua39pex9k9mu9geqdlr2hg3m2ca
transaction
07abbf312748e1b5cb00188041c694cf7f388d0d3eb1ea01e2f655465961290d
spent
true